When photographing iconic city landmarks, consider the following tips:

  • Shoot from unusual angles to add a unique perspective to your photos.
  • Pay attention to lighting conditions, and attempt to capture the landmark during the golden hour for a warm, golden glow.
  • Experiment with different lenses and equipment to achieve a desired depth of field or blur effect.

Q: What are some essential gear and tips for photographing sunrises and sunsets?

A: Some essential gear includes a wide-angle lens, a tripod, and a camera with manual modes. Tips include arriving early, using a remote shutter release or timer, and experimenting with different compositions and angles.

 

Q: How do I approach and photograph strangers in street photography?

A: It’s essential to obtain consent and respect your subjects. Start by observing and taking note of people’s body language, and then approach them in a friendly and non-threatening manner.
